INTRODUCTION: India being the second highly populated nation in the world. HIV/AIDS has acquired pandemic proportion in the world. Estimate by WHO for current infection rate in Asia. India has the third largest HIV epidemic in the world. HIV prevalence in the age group 15-49 yrs was an estimate of 0.2%. India has been classified as an intermediate in the Hepatitis B Virus (HBV) endemic (HBsAg carriage 2-7%) zone with the second largest global pool of chronic HBV infections. Safety assessment of the blood supply, the quality of screening measures and the risk of transfusion transmitted infectious diseases (TTIs) in any country can be estimated by scrutinizing the files of blood donors. After the introduction of the blood banks and improved storage facilities, it became more extensively used. Blood is one of the major sources of TTIs like hepatitis B, hepatitis C, HIV, syphilis, and many other blood borne diseases. Disclosure of these threats brought a dramatic change in attitude of physicians and patients about blood transfusion. The objective of this study is to determine the seroprevalence of transfusion transmitted infections amidst voluntary blood donors at a rural tertiary healthcare teaching hospital in Chhattisgarh. MATERIAL AND METHODS: This retrospective study was carried out in Chandulal Chandrakar Memorial Medical College, Kachandur, Durg. Blood donors were volunteers, or and commercial donors who donated the blood and paid by patients, their families, or friends to replace blood used or expected to be used for patients from the blood bank of the hospital. After proper donation of blood routine screening of blood was carried out according to standard protocol. Laboratory diagnosis of HIV 1 and HIV 2 was carried out by ELISA test. Hepatitis B surface antigen was screened by using ELISA. RESULTS: A total of 1915 consecutive blood donors’ sera were screened at Chandulal Chandrakar Memorial Medical College, blood bank during study period. Of these 1914 were male and 1 female. The mean age of patients was found to be 29.34 years with standard deviation (SD) of 11.65 Years. Among all blood donors in present study, 759(39.63%) were first time donors and 1156(60.37%) were repeated donors. 1 patient was HIV positive in first donation group while 3 (75%) were positive in repeat donation group. 7 (38.9%) were HBsAg positive in in first donation group while 11(61.1%) were positive in repeat donation group. Two patients in first donation group had dual infection of HIV and HBsAg. CONCLUSION: Seropositivity was high in repeated donors as compared to first time donors. The incidence of HIV is observed to be 0.2% and that of HBsAg is 0.94%. Strict selection of blood donors should be done to avoid transfusion-transmissible infections during the window period.

Abstract Objective:To ascertain the frequency of markers of transfusion-transmitted infections. among blood donors in a blood bank at a tertiary care hospital Material and Methods:The study was a retrospective cross-sectional descriptive study, covering from 1stJanuary 2013- October 2018 and was conducted in the blood bank section, in the Department of Pathology at Dow University of HealthSciences, Hospital. All blood donors were screened for hepatitis B, hepatitis C, HIV (I & II), syphilis through electrochemiluminescence and malaria (immunochromatography).Data was entered and subsequently analyzed by statistical package for social sciences (SPSS) version 21. The frequency of infectious disease markers (HbsAg, Anti HCV, HIV, syphilis, and malaria) was calculated among blood donors. Results:The total number of donors in our study was 29732, out of which 2587 donors were positive for an infectious disease.Out of the total donors, 29712 were male and 20 were female. There were 12 volunteer donors and 29720 exchange donors. The mean prevalence of donors with positive infectious markers was as follows; Anti HCV was 3 %, HbsAg was 2.9%, Syphilis was 2.0%, HIV was 0.5% and Malaria was 0.02 %. Conclusion:HbsAg and Anti HCV were the most frequent infections (3%) found in our blood donors, followed by syphilis with a frequency of 2%. Background: Transfusion of blood has become an important mode of transmission of infections such as human immunodeficiency virus and hepatitis B to the recipients. Blood transfusion is a boon in medical era if properly screened. The aim of study was to determine the seroprevalence of HIV donors in blood bank at M.Y.H. Indore.Methods: The study was conducted in the blood bank, M.Y.H. Hospital, Indore. Total 115775 donors attending blood bank were included in the study. All the donor samples were screened for detection of antibodies for human immunodeficiency virus by microwell Enzyme Linked Immunosorption Assay (ELISA) method. The seroprevalence of HIV infection among the donors was determined over a period of five years since January 2013 to December 2017.Results: Total 115775 blood donors were recorded. Out of total 115775 blood donors included in the study, replacement donor were 10766 (9.29%) while voluntary donor were 105009 (90.70%). In the duration of five-year study period, total 80 cases (0.06%) were reactive to HIV. Out of total 115775 blood donors included in the study, maximum cases i.e. 22 (0.08%) cases were found to be positive for HIV infection in year 2017. Out of 10766 replacement donors included in the study, 64 cases (0.59%) were reactive to HIV infection. While out of 105009 voluntary donors, 16 cases (0.01%) were found to be reactive to HIV infection. Voluntary donors are more as compared to the replacement donors. Number of HIV positive patients were found to more in replacement donor as compared to the voluntary donors.Conclusions: The seroprevalence of HIV is low in this study and hence it is concluded that the more the number of voluntary donors, the less the number of HIV positive cases. Voluntary donors can be motivated by proper health education and high quality screening programs.

Context: The current regulatory requirements for donor eligibility pose a challenge to blood centers in recruitment of voluntary blood donors, particularly in a developing country like India where awareness of the general population is low and myths about blood donation are prevalent. This study evaluates the reasons and rates of donor deferral in a tertiary hospital-based blood bank in western India.Aim: To find rates and reasons for deferral of voluntary blood donors in a city in western India.Settings and design: A retrospective study was done on blood donors during a 3-month period. Data collection was done by electronic records of blood donors.Materials and Methods: The study was conducted retrospectively at a tertiary care hospital in western India. All those who donated whole blood between 1st January 2011 and 31st March 2011 were included in the study. Data was collected using local blood bank software.Statistical analysis used: No statistical technique used as it is a data article.Results: 60.5% of donors were young, below 30 years of age. Donors were predominantly male (91.6%). Voluntary donors comprised 88% of the donors. Total deferral rate was 22.36%, with 17.29% permanent deferrals and 82.71% temporary deferrals. Main reasons for deferral were anemia 39.42%, low body weight 14.29%, hypertension 10.73%, age below 18 years 10.73% and history of medication 6.09%. The common causes of deferral between our study and other similar studies are the same.Conclusion: We concluded that majority of the donor population belongs to 18–30-year-old age group. This is encouraging with a voluntary blood donation initiative. Donor self exclusion and strict donor selection criteria application should be addressed by more proactive measures to make blood donation a safe and pleasurable experience.

Microbiological safety is very important aspect of blood transfusion services (BTS). Viral infectious agents possess a great risk of transfusion transmitted disease. On the one hand, blood or component transfusion is a lifesaving modality but on the other hand it can cause great mortality or morbidity in recipient if not used judiciously. The main aim of the study is to evaluate the prevalence of HIV, HBV, HCV, Syphilis and Malaria amongst all types of donors donated at blood bank of Sir Sunderlal Hospital, Institute of Medical Sciences, Banaras Hindu University, Varanasi during the year 2017. This was a retrospective study. The blood donors included in this study include all donors coming directly to blood bank and blood donation camps organized by blood bank. Total donation during that period was 22255 units. A detailed questionnaire was given to the donors for registration. A total of 226 units (1.01%) were seropositive. The sero-prevalence of HIV, HBV, HCV, and Syphilis were 0.9% (21), 0.79% (177), 0.09% (22), 0.02% (6) respectively. No cases of malaria were detected. TTI can be reduced by motivating maximum voluntary blood donation, reducing replacement donation, public information and donor education awareness programme, stringent donor screening criteria and vigilance of error.

Background: Critical part of transfusion is effective screening of TTI, to reduce the risk of transmission is as safe as possible. The present study has undertaken to focus on seroprevalence of TTIs among both voluntary and replacement donors and also to project epidemiological data of TTIs in this community.Methods: This is a retrospective study conducted from January 2014 to December 2018. All blood samples collected from donors were screened for HIV, HBV, HCV, Syphilis and malaria according to blood bank policy. Before drawing blood, donors were asked to fill pre structured Blood bank questionnaire and consent form.Results: In this present 5-year study, total number of blood donor population was 54937, among them voluntary donors were 33891 and replacement donors were 21046. Out of 33891 voluntary donors, 33486(98.8%) were males and remaining 405(1.19%) were females. All replacement donors (21046) were males. The seroprevalence of HBV was highest, 1.82% (1003/54937) followed by HCV 0.31% (175/54937) in all the donors. The seropositivity for HIV is 0.23% (129/54937), for syphilis 0.04% (24/54937) and for malaria 0.01% (6/54937).Conclusions: National blood transfusion policy should be strengthening the standards and quality of screening across the country. For blood screening, resources and appropriate screening assays must be available at all health centres.

Background: With over 93 million donations made every year worldwide, blood transfusion continues to save millions of lives each year and improve the life expectancy and quality of life of patients suffering from life threatening conditions. At the same time, blood transfusion is an important mode of transmission of infection to the recipient. The present study was conducted to estimate the prevalence of HIV, HBV and HCV infections in voluntary blood donors at a tertiary care teaching hospital in Mumbai over a decade.Methods: All voluntary donors reporting to the blood bank were screened for HIV, HBsAg and HCV by using the appropriate enzyme linked immunosorbent assay. The study was designed for duration of ten years between January 2008 to December 2017. Medical reports of the donors were accessed from the blood bank records and analyzed.Results: A total of 8928 voluntary blood donors were screened. Amongst the blood donors, seropositivity of HBV (6% to 1.52 %) was highest followed by HIV (2.5% to 0.15%) then HCV (1.85% to 0.37%).Conclusions: Decreasing trends with low prevalence observed in the study is an encouraging sign supporting the growing awareness of these life-threatening diseases.
